What Is Personal Home Care Assistance?

Caregivers perform daily tasks your loved one can’t. Non-medical support includes bathing, dressing, cooking,
cleaning, moving, and chatting — all within the comfort of their home.

This service is perfect for families who want parents to age safely at home, without rushing into a rehab or nursing home.
Think of it as peace of mind, delivered daily.

What Services Are Included in Personal Care Help at Home?

A professional home care aide in Pittsburgh can assist with:

  • Bathing and dressing help
  • Toileting and incontinence support
  • Grooming, hygiene, and oral care
  • Mobility and transfer assistance
  • Meal preparation and feeding support
  • Light housekeeping and laundry
  • Medication reminders (non-medical)
  • Transportation to medical appointments
  • Social companionship and emotional support

All tasks are tailored to your parent’s needs and comfort level.

When Is the Right Time to Get Help?

If your parent is:

  • Forgetting medication
  • Struggling with daily hygiene
  • Wearing the same clothes for days
  • Falling more often
  • Feeling lonely or withdrawn
  • Missing appointments or meals

These red flags mean it’s time to consider home aid for the elderly in Pittsburgh.
